| AN ACT |
| |
1 | Amending Title 4 (Amusements) of the Pennsylvania Consolidated |
2 | Statutes, further providing for the definition of "slot |
3 | machine." |
4 | The General Assembly of the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ania |
5 | hereby enacts as follows: |
6 | Section 1. The definition of "slot machine" in section 1103 |
7 | of Title 4 of the Pennsylvania Consolidated Statutes is amended |
8 | to read: |
9 | § 1103. Definitions. |
10 | The following words and phrases when used in this part shall |
11 | have the meanings given to them in this section unless the |
12 | context clearly indicates otherwise: |
13 | * * * |
14 | "Slot machine." Any mechanical or electrical contrivance, |
15 | terminal, machine or other device approved by the Pennsylvania |
16 | Gaming Control Board which, upon insertion of a coin, bill, |
17 | ticket, token or similar object therein or upon payment of any |
18 | consideration whatsoever, including the use of any electronic |
|
1 | payment system except a credit card or debit card, is available |
2 | to play or operate, the play or operation of which, whether by |
3 | reason of skill or application of the element of chance or both, |
4 | may deliver or entitle the person or persons playing or |
5 | operating the contrivance, terminal, machine or other device to |
6 | receive cash, billets, tickets, tokens or electronic credits to |
7 | be exchanged for cash or to receive merchandise or anything of |
8 | value whatsoever, whether the payoff is made automatically from |
9 | the machine or manually. A slot machine: |
10 | (1) May utilize spinning reels or video displays or |
11 | both. |
12 | (2) May or may not dispense coins, tickets or tokens to |
13 | winning patrons. |
14 | (3) May use an electronic credit system for receiving |
15 | wagers and making payouts. |
16 | The term shall include associated equipment necessary to conduct |
17 | the operation of the contrivance, terminal, machine or other |
18 | device. The term shall not include a mechanical or electrical |
19 | contrivance, terminal, machine or other device that permits the |
20 | playing of virtual blackjack and virtual roulette. |
21 | * * * |
22 | Section 2. This act shall take effect in 60 days. |
